Carnage Racing

Know somebody who might be like this game?

What is a Season Pass?
Carnage Racing Season Passes are one-off purchases that entitle you to DLC released over a set period of time. This is not a purchase of the full game itself.


Carnage Racing Activation Instructions

Game Information
Release Date September 19, 2013
Publisher tinyGIANT Games, Jagex Ltd. Games Studio
Game Modes Single player, Multiplayer
Player Perspectives Third person
Genres Racing, Strategy
Themes Action
Platforms PC (Microsoft Windows), Mac, iOS